The divine architect A sermon On Psalm Cxxvii. 1. Preached on Thursday, 2d of June, 1785, in the meeting-house, In Cannon-Street New-Road, White-Chapel: before the Middlesex Society, For Educating Poor Children in the Protestant Religion: on Occasion of laying the First stone of the Building to be Erected there, For Schools to contain upwards of 200 Children, and other Apartments for the Use of the said Charity. by Stephen Addington, D.
